Sour Patch Easter "Eggs"
 
 
These sour patch grapes - just fresh grapes rolled in jello powder - are a healthier alternative to candy. They're so much fun to make and will satisfy your little egg hunters' sweet tooth!

Yield: 3 cups
Ingredients
  • 1 pound (about 2½ cups) green grapes
  • Flavored gelatin (jello) mix in different colors
  • A small spray bottle filled with water
Instructions
  1. Pick grapes off the stems. Rinse them in cold running water. Drain, but don't dry.
  2. While grapes are still damp, place a handful in a bowl.
  3. Sprinkle with jello powder. Toss and roll grapes in the powder.
  4. Spray areas that didn't get enough coverage with water.
  5. Immediately sprinkle more powder. Toss again, until most grapes are evenly coated in jello powder
  6. Transfer coated grapes to a plate or another bowl and chill in the fridge for a couple of hours, until serving time.
